The present invention relates to a portable blood glucose meter. A temperature measurement medium whose temperature rapidly changes according to the change in the external temperature, is mounted on one side of a case to be exposed to the outside, and the temperature of the temperature measurement medium is measured by an infrared temperature sensor in a non-contact manner. As a blood glucose measurement result is calculated by taking into account the measured temperature, the external temperature of an actual blood glucose measurement environment can be accurately reflected, thereby enhancing the accuracy of the blood glucose measurement result. By configuring the temperature measurement medium to sensitively react to the external temperature independently from the case, the temperature change of the temperature measurement medium according to the change in the external temperature is carried out quickly and accurately. Therefore, more accurate temperature measurement is possible, and a user can calculate a blood glucose measurement result more accurately. |
